Fungal Infections: Tinea Versicolor
Fungal infections include a host of divergent disorders ranging from the most minor to the more serious. Tinea Versicolor is one of the most minor infections, but one that can be difficult to eradicate entirely.
Tinea Versicolor is also known as pityriasis versicolor and involves a discoloration of the skin pigment. Patches are often found on the back and chest and are reddish or brown in colour but can turn white in the sun.
Tinea Versicolor is not a serious disorder, as the fungus that causes this particular infection only affects the top layer of the skin. It is furthermore non-contagious and is found most commonly in adolescents and young adults. The fungus eats the oils of the surface oils of the skin and it is believed that those with oilier skin are more prone to these times of infections.
Getting overheated or sweating profusely can aggravate the condition. A hot shower, the sunshine or excessive sweat can also be responsible for making the patches a lighter shade. Often these rashes can be mistaken for ringworm so it is always best to have a doctor or health care practitioner get a good look in order to make the treatment most effective.
Because Tinea Versicolor is a fungal infections over the counter fungal remedies can be effective. These are stubborn infections however so you need to be quite persistent if you hope to do away with them entirely. Using Selsum blue shampoo is also a remedy for this fungus as it contains selenium sulfide.
